#f448f9 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#f448f9 is composed of 95.7% red, 28.2% green and 97.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 2% cyan, 71.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 2.4% black. It has a hue angle of 298.3 degrees, a saturation of 93.7% and a lightness of 62.9%. #f448f9 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ff90ff with #e900f3. Closest websafe color is: #ff33ff.

#f448f9 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#f448f9 has RGB values of R:244, G:72, B:249 and CMYK values of C:0.02, M:0.71, Y:0, K:0.02. Its decimal value is 16009465.

Hex triplet f448f9 #f448f9
RGB Decimal 244, 72, 249 rgb(244,72,249)
RGB Percent 95.7, 28.2, 97.6 rgb(95.7%,28.2%,97.6%)
CMYK 2, 71, 0, 2
HSL 298.3°, 93.7, 62.9 hsl(298.3,93.7%,62.9%)
HSV (or HSB) 298.3°, 71.1, 97.6
Web Safe ff33ff #ff33ff
CIE-LAB 62.263, 83.624, -54.523
XYZ 56.723, 30.711, 92.558
xyY 0.315, 0.171, 30.711
CIE-LCH 62.263, 99.828, 326.896
CIE-LUV 62.263, 70.855, -97.69
Hunter-Lab 55.417, 85.726, -60.233
Binary 11110100, 01001000, 11111001

Shades and Tints of #f448f9

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070007 is the darkest color, while #fef3ff is the lightest one.

Tones of #f448f9

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a29fa2 is the less saturated color, while #f448f9 is the most saturated one.

Color Blindness Simulator

Below, you can see how #f448f9 is perceived by people affected by a color vision deficiency. This can be useful if you need to ensure your color combinations are accessible to color-blind users.

Monochromacy
  • #909090 Achromatopsia 0.005% of the population
  • #a482a5 Atypical Achromatopsia 0.001% of the population
Dichromacy
  • #6898ff Protanopia 1% of men
  • #739be6 Deuteranopia 1% of men
  • #e57c84 Tritanopia 0.001% of the population
Trichromacy
  • #9b7bfc Protanomaly 1% of men, 0.01% of women
  • #a27dec Deuteranomaly 6% of men, 0.4% of women
  • #ea69ae Tritanomaly 0.01% of the population
